## Formula sandbox tuning

User-supplied formulas in Gridmoor execute inside a restricted interpreter with hard ceilings on time, memory, and call depth. Reviewers should confirm any change to these ceilings is justified in the PR description, since raising them widens the abuse surface. Defaults were chosen from production traces. The current limits are as follows.

limits module of tafog-fawip:
WEIGHTS = {
    "julix": 57,
    "lamys": 992,
    "kasvan": 209,
    "quenok": 750,
    "alddor": 259,
    "oliath": 1009,
    "wenix": 815,
}

**Ticket: Intermittent connection failures — Flagwright rollout framework**

For the security review: since the Flagwright 3.2 deploy, the flag-evaluation service intermittently fails to reach its audit database during rollout windows, dropping roughly 2% of evaluation logs. TLS handshakes succeed; failures occur at authentication. No credential rotation occurred this quarter. The affected service connects to the audit database using the connection string below.

warehouse DSN: mssql://rusdor_svc:0FSWCn9@db-951a.paliqforge.local:5432/ulawyn

**Test Plan: Bulk Edits in the Pendle Admin Table**

Hey plugin folks — bulk edits in the Pendle admin grid now batch in chunks of 200 rows, so your hooks fire per-chunk, not per-row. Please test: selecting across pages, mixed-permission rows, and undo after a partial failure. Your plugin shouldn't assume row order. Run everything against the sandbox tenant, not production. To hit the sandbox bulk-edit endpoint, authenticate with the token shown below.

session JWT of yawep-yawep = eyJhbGciOiJIUzI1NiIsInR5cCI6IkpXVCJ9.eyJzdWIiOiI3pWF3_In0.aXYsHiog

Hi — handing over catalog release duties for Pallaster Goods while I'm out. Cache invalidation runs after every catalog publish: the Drayhorn job purges edge caches region by region, starting with Westmoor. If a purge stalls, rerun it rather than forcing a full flush, which hammers origin. Publish artifacts won't be accepted by the invalidation service unless they're signed, and you'll need to load the signing key into your local release tooling. For reference, the current key is below.

deploy key for tahaf-yahif: bky6_LGffbe